R-Truth Credits A Fan For Coming Up With Royal Rumble Ladder Spot

R-Truth says that a fan came up with one of his best Royal Rumble spots.

In the 2016 Royal Rumble match, R-Truth entered the match at the #12 spot. In a hilarious moment, Truth set up a ladder in the middle of the ring, as he seemingly thought that he was in a Money In The Bank ladder match.

Speaking with Adrian Hernandez of Unlikely for a new interview, Truth named the spot as the favorite Royal Rumble moment of his career.

“[The ladder one] is probably going to be the top one, man. I like the one when I threw Big Show and Mark Henry over the top rope too. They was hot.”

Truth went on to reveal that a fan pitched the idea to him.

“Believe it or not, it was a fan’s idea. I pitched it to creative and they [went with it]. I read them all. I pitched it. A fan gave me that idea.”
